Sierra Leone: UK helps turn on the taps for clean water
05 Mar 08
DFID, 23 February 2008The UK has launched a £32 million, five-year water, sanitation and hygiene education programme in Sierra Leone. The programme, which is run in conjunction with UNICEF and the Sierra Leone Government, will provide an additional 1.5 million people with safe water, improved sanitation and hygiene education and will help [...]
